| lively as a coma Join Date: Jul 2007 Location: Michigan | Unreadable Disk Xbox 360
Well, my Xbox is now illiterate I suppose. When on the Xbox "Dashboard," on the bottom of the screen where it says the name of the disc in the xbox, mine just says unplayable disc. I tried multiple games and dvds, but with no success. I emailed Microsoft 2 weeks ago and asked them what the problem is. I have yet to receive a response. I do not think it is still under warranty, because i got it 2 years ago. Any of you intelligent and oh so kind gentlemen and or gentleladies know what is happening? |

Could be the lens is going, could be the laser is dying, could be the motor isnt working in the drive. Lots of possibilities. Sounds like a laser though if it wont read other DVDs. I get a read error every now and then, usually I just eject the disc, inspect it, blow off any dust and stick it back in without a problem.

There's a good chance your machine is no longer compatible with disc based media. Here'sa couple things to try: Open the tray and blow out the drive with some compressed computer cleaner. Strike it smartly on the top of the case above the drive(do it at your own risk because you may break something) to see if there is a part that will fall back into allignment and begin working again. Call XBOX and see if they will still let you buy an extended warranty. If so, send it in as soon as you get your paperwork. Force a RROD failure. I heard that people will wrap heavy towels or blankets around their 360 and run it until it gets the RROD. That's covered under a 3 year warranty and will most likely get you a new or refurbed box. Again, do this at your own risk and be aware that you could kill the box without the RROD or burn down your house. Do not leave it unattended while trying to cook it. Finally, what I would probably do is suck it up and buy an Arcade 360 and swap my HDD from the broken one. Then sell the broken one on ebay. Modders will buy them and replace the drive so if the box works good otherwise you may get a decent buck for it and have a new 360 for not much more than paying MS for a repair.
